Trauma Recovery: Empowering Survivors

Trauma recovery is a critical area of mental health that focuses on helping individuals heal from the effects of traumatic experiences. Trauma can result from many situations, including accidents, natural disasters, or interpersonal violence, and can lead to severe emotional and psychological distress. Trauma-informed care is essential in these cases, as it involves understanding, recognizing, and responding to the effects of all types of trauma. Therapy for trauma recovery may include techniques such as EMDR (Eye Movement Desensitization and Reprocessing), trauma-focused cognitive behavioral therapy, and support groups, all aimed at empowering survivors to reclaim their lives.

Sleep Disorder Treatment: Waking Up Refreshed

Sleep disorders, such as insomnia, sleep apnea, and restless legs syndrome, can significantly impact one’s health and quality of life. Treatment for these conditions may include behavioral strategies, such as sleep hygiene education and cognitive-behavioral therapy for insomnia, as well as medical treatments like CPAP machines for sleep apnea. Effective management of sleep disorders aims to restore restful sleep, thereby improving energy levels, mood, and overall health.

OCD Support: Confidence Without Rituals

Obsessive-Compulsive Disorder (OCD) is a chronic anxiety disorder characterized by uncontrollable, recurring thoughts (obsessions) and behaviors (compulsions) that the individual feels the urge to repeat over and over. Effective OCD support helps individuals break free from these rituals through techniques such as Exposure and Response Prevention (ERP), cognitive-behavioral therapy, and medication. Building confidence and learning to manage anxiety without relying on compulsive behaviors are key goals of OCD treatment.

Psychotherapy: Mental Patterns and Mindfulness

Psychotherapy is a fundamental treatment approach in mental health that involves exploring thoughts, emotions, and behaviors to improve an individual’s well-being. Techniques such as mindfulness-based therapy can be particularly effective in helping individuals recognize and alter detrimental mental patterns. Mindfulness encourages a state of active, open attention on the present moment and can help reduce stress, enhance emotional regulation, and improve overall mental health.
